Converting mixed fractions into simple decimals and fractions is a straightforward process that involves breaking down the mixed fraction into its components. A mixed fraction is a combination of a whole number and a fraction, such as 2 3/4. To convert this into a simple fraction, you need to multiply the whole number by the denominator and add the numerator, then write the result as a fraction. For example, 2 3/4 can be converted to 23/4. To convert this into a decimal, you can divide the numerator by the denominator, resulting in 5.75.

One common misconception about converting mixed fractions is that it is a complex and difficult process. However, with practice and patience, anyone can learn to convert mixed fractions into simple decimals and fractions. Another misconception is that converting fractions is only necessary for students in advanced math classes. However, understanding fractions and decimals is an essential skill that is used in many everyday applications, from cooking to finance.
